OTTAWA — $94,000 dinners, $915 flower arrangements and $1,340 for “musical spoons.”
That’s just a small list of expenses incurred for a pair of plush government conferences in 2024 that collectively cost taxpayers $1.03 million, according to government disclosures .
Held last year in Montreal from July 5 to 8, the 49th annual cost taxpayers $631,569 for the three-day event — a figure that includes accommodations, transportation, food, per diems and artistic performances.
